  LOS ANGELES, CA, May 11 (MARKET WIRE) -- 
Sharal Churchill, President of Media Creature Music, and Danny Benair,
President of Natural Energy Lab, have formed a new firm, Benair
Churchill, which will be a proactive Music Publishing company for
songwriters and artists and a Post Production shop for advertisers.

    Media Creature Music has produced music for major commercial campaigns
including spots for Old Navy, American Express, Budweiser, Nike, and
T-Mobile, to name a few, as well as licensing its own music to
Film/TV/Advertisers/Games/Trailers. The firm's services include music
publishing, retail releases, music supervision/clearance, music
composition and post-production services. Churchill says, "We've saved
companies millions because we bring specialized skills, established work
practices and a highly efficient system for production with a faster
output to market."

    Natural Energy Lab represents labels and artists for Film, TV and
Advertising and its songs have premiered in ads for AT&T, Target, Payless
Shoes, and in "Grey's Anatomy," "The Curious Case of Benjamin Button," and
"Crank 2." Before forming Natural Energy Lab, Danny was Vice President of
the Film & Television Department at Polygram Music Publishing where he was
responsible for The Cardigans writing "Lovefool" for Baz Luhrman's "Romeo
and Juliet" and also Adam Schlesinger writing the theme song "That Thing
You Do" for Tom Hanks' Academy Award nominated motion picture. Benair has
